whats the exact purpose of RAS?

to stop unwanted rocker arm movement.

Basicly to stop the rocker arm form floating at high rpm’s or with a bigger cam.

How much power do you need to be putting out to actually require this?

What I’ve heard is that it is used for people in the high RPM’s all the time. Big power, yes. But more so with high RPM.

After 7400RPM what out for flying valvetrain. Its a good investment considering what could happen without them.

if you are using stock cams you really don’t need them.

It is for people that have or will want a bigger cam in the future more than anything.

If you have a stock turbo, there’s no power up there anyways. If you have the airflow for above 7krpm, you’ll want the insurance. Cheap and easy to install. Aftermarket copies are easy to find.
